Battle Creek, MI — Ancilla College will send two golfers to the NJCAA Men’s National Golf Championship being hosted at Swan Lake Resort in Plymouth this year.
Jalen Satterfield shot a two-day total of 160 which was 16 over par, but good enough to qualify him as an individual for the tournament. Satterfield shot an 81 on a less than desirable first day and a 79 on an almost perfect second day at the NJCAA Region 12 Division II Tournament at Bedford Valley Golf Course. Bedford Valley is a par 72, 6556-yard course.
Carl Martinez will also be returning home to the nationals, but he had to do a little extra work to get there. Martinez post a two-day total of 23 over par 167. An 86 on the first day put added pressure on him, but he shot a 9 over 81 on day two to tie for the final individual qualifying spot for nationals. He won a one-hole playoff to advance.
“It has been a tough spring with only three golfers, but to get two of them to nationals shows that the hard work paid off,” said 1st year coach Joe Steenbeke. “Both of these guys have shown steady improvement all season and I am proud of the way they have stepped up and qualified for nationals. Next week will be fun playing on our home course.”
The NJCAA Division II Golf National championship gets underway May 21-24 at Swan Lake Resort in Plymouth, IN. This will be the fourth time Ancilla College and Swan Lake has hosted the tournament.
